  2. On 9/5/2018 at 8:14 AM, N400fiasco said:

    What does it show as the earliest available date on the initial screen in USTraveldocs? Keep in mind , the OFC date has to be within 30 days of the whatever the earliest date available is , otherwise it will say no dates available on the next screen. Also , once you do grab the first available date  for an appointment, create another dummy ustraveldocs account to keep checking the earliest date available (since it wont be visible on the main account once you schedule an appointment)
